JD 2012 2013.jpg Not sure if this will show up or not. I Tried to attach one photo showing a 2012 748 and a 2013 738. Compare each one. There is no difference in the setback of the Hood or more frame sticking out. The changes that do show are The seat, Hood Vents top and side, Headlights and grill. The 738 shows a drive over deck and diff. bracket for the deck wheels. This being U shaped and not L shaped as on the 2012. Also a diff. in the tool box.
